Output 8d9880a948284af5e39a47d227372bafd2fc0ab85e3dd1529a87d9f3524895ea:3

value
423097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a02d0303d3329b97b0e02c9330a630eedccf34 OP_EQUAL
address
39DuDV7FfSDc62VWBfGKrY2Ha1xJgnt5eV
transaction
8d9880a948284af5e39a47d227372bafd2fc0ab85e3dd1529a87d9f3524895ea
spent
true